Description of the Position: (Purpose of the Position):


The job involves looking for articles and making scans from certain medical journals that are kept in the National Library of Medicine in Bethesda MD. In some cases you will receive specific bibliographical information down to the page number and other times you will have to look for key words and scan any article you can find that contains them.


Transferable Skills:
This job is a great opportunity to get some initial research experience. The research assistant will learn to navigate a big research library order and consult materials in the target language (Russian). It is also an invaluable opportunity to gain a historical background in nineteenth-century print culture and medical history in the Russian Empire.


Duties and Responsibilities:
Find and scan relevant articles from the selected medical journals.


Qualifications: (Education/Experience/Skills)

Currently enrolled student at St. Olaf College
Very good Russian language knowledge (best if completed Russian 302 or equivalent)
Ability to work with minimal supervision
Dependable and punctual
Great organizational skills
